Kadhahikhodra Population - Kanker, Chhattisgarh
Kadhahikhodra is a medium size village located in Antagarh Tehsil of Kanker district, Chhattisgarh with total 109 families residing. The Kadhahikhodra village has population of 580 of which 310 are males while 270 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kadhahikhodra village population of children with age 0-6 is 103 which makes up 17.76 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kadhahikhodra village is 871 which is lower than Chhattisgarh state average of 991. Child Sex Ratio for the Kadhahikhodra as per census is 635, lower than Chhattisgarh average of 969.
Kadhahikhodra village has lower literacy rate compared to Chhattisgarh. In 2011, literacy rate of Kadhahikhodra village was 70.02 % compared to 70.28 % of Chhattisgarh. In Kadhahikhodra Male literacy stands at 84.62 % while female literacy rate was 54.35 %.

Kadhahikhodra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 109 | - | - |
Population | 580 | 310 | 270 |
Child (0-6) | 103 | 63 | 40 |
Schedule Caste | 28 | 16 | 12 |
Schedule Tribe | 525 | 278 | 247 |
Literacy | 70.02 % | 84.62 % | 54.35 % |
Total Workers | 346 | 178 | 168 |
Main Worker | 108 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 238 | 76 | 162 |
